Average Life Expectancy of Industrial Racks
With normal warehouse conditions, high-quality industrial racks will last between 15 and 25 years on average. In industries with heavy usage where the loads are severe and machines move regularly, the life duration can be 10-15 years. But when the conditions are favorable, and the building is properly kept, then racks should be in service for 25 or more years.
Industrial racks are not provided with an expiry date. Their lifespan is based on the responsibility for which they are used and maintained. When properly taken care of, they may last a long time before they are worn out, whereas when neglected, they may die very fast. Key Factors that Influence the Lifespan of Industrial Racks
Material Quality
The quality of steel used in the manufacture of the industrial racks determines their durability. Structural steel comes in different thicknesses, strengths, and finishes.
● Beams that are at the thick end will be more resistant to bending.
● Load-bearing capacity is enhanced by high-grade steel.
● Corrosion is resisted by powder-coated or galvanized finishes.
● Poor steel corrodes easily under stress.

Load Capacity and Distribution of Weight
Each industrial racking system has its load rating. Surpassing such a limit is among the main causes of structural damage. Regular overloading may cause:
● Beam bending
● Frame misalignment
● Connector loosening
● Structural stress is permanent
Minor overloading throughout prolonged durations decreases the net strength. Correct labeling of load limits and employee education can be used to ensure safe weight distribution and increase the lifespan of the racks. Environmental Conditions
The duration of racks is largely determined by the environmental exposure. Controlled humidity in indoor warehouses would produce optimal weather conditions that are conducive to longevity. There are, however, environments that enhance wear and tear.
Factors leading to less lifespan are:
● High humidity levels
● Water leakage or flooding
● Chemical exposure
● Coastal salt air
● Installation outside and uncovered
Humid areas have significant risks of rust and corrosion. Wear and tear corrosion can be significantly reduced by ensuring good ventilation and the use of coverings that are resistant to corrosion. Equipment Impact Damage
Pallet jacks and forklifts are used around racking systems on a daily basis. Accidental impacts are prevalent in warehouse environments that are high in busy warehouses and may weaken the structural components in the long run.
Recurrent collisions can lead to:
● Dented beams
● Bent columns
● Misaligned frames
● Damaged anchor bolts
The damage may seem small, but it may affect the stability of loads. Column guards, rack protectors, and safety barriers will minimize the impact-related damage and increase the overall rack life. Installation Quality
It is essential to be installed correctly to achieve maximum durability. In case the racks are not assembled and anchored properly, the structural stress rises. Poor installation would result in:
● Uneven weight distribution
● Additional strain on the joints
● Anchor bolt failure
● Premature wear

Maintenance and Inspection Practices
The maintenance conducted on industrial racks on a regular basis is also a major factor that influences the durability of the rack. Maintenance routine will consist:
● Monthly visual inspections
● Inspection of bolts and connectors.
● Monitoring beam alignment
● Looking at whether rust is formed.
● Timely replacement of damaged parts.
Little problems may lead to big structural failures because they are ignored. Preventive maintenance not only prolongs the lifetime, but it is also a way of guaranteeing the safety of the workplace. Signs Your Industrial Racks Need Replacement
Durable racks, too, at length wear out. These warning signs can be identified early to avoid accidents and unwanted downtime that is very expensive.
Common signs include:
● Apparent bending or warping of beams.
● Severe rust or corrosion
● Cracked weld joints
● Leaning or unstable frames
● Frequent load instability
In case the structural integrity is affected, replacement of the system is a safer solution than temporary solutions. Safety should be considered first and foremost before cost saving.
Can Industrial Racks Last 30 Years?
Industrial racks can indeed last between 25 and 30 years or even more in some conditions. Facilities that are managed under controlled conditions with minimum impact damage and maintain optimal weight control tend to have a long life.
Nevertheless, old racks that seem to be stable must be professionally checked. Safety rules and work demands can be changed, and the upgrades are required to ensure safety and efficiency.
